Purpose

This is a sample project that combines NextJS, Material UI, and a smattering of techniques using React hooks. The photo grid page is an infinite-scrolling grid view using the sample Elder Scrolls Legends API to display simplified cards that you can search for by name.

To run this repo locally

Clone the repo. Then, use yarn:

yarn install
yarn dev

If you'd like to run unit tests:

yarn test

You can run these with npm if you'd like - the only difference is that you'll generate a package-lock.json file that subsequent yarn builds won't be happy about.
